What is writing fluency?
Writing fluency refers to the ease and fluency with which a person is able to write. It includes the ability to express ideas clearly, coherently and convincingly, using appropriate language and respecting grammatical and syntactic rules. A person with writing fluency masters the art of communicating effectively in writing, whether in a professional, academic or personal context. They are able to structure their ideas, choose the right words and adapt their writing style according to the target audience.

How to do a Writing test?
To take a writing test, you can follow these steps:
Determine the topic: Choose a specific topic on which you want to assess writing skills. This can be a topic related to your field of activity or a general topic.
Set guidelines: Establish clear guidelines for the test, such as text length, format (article, letter, report, etc.), expected tone (formal, informal), and any other specific requirements.
Provide resources if needed: If the topic requires additional information or specific sources, be sure to provide these to candidates to assist them in their writing.
Set a time limit: Set a time limit for completing the test to simulate real-world conditions and assess the candidate's ability to perform within a given time frame.
Assess Grammar and Spelling: When evaluating the test, consider the quality of grammar, spelling, and syntax used by the candidate. A good command of these aspects is essential for effective writing.
Analyze structure and organization: Evaluate how the candidate organizes his or her ideas and structures his or her text. Look for a clear introduction, well-developed paragraphs, and a relevant conclusion.
Assess writing style: Pay close attention to the candidate's writing style, looking for elements such as clarity, conciseness, coherence, and originality.
Consider the content and arguments: Evaluate the relevance of the content proposed by the candidate as well as the quality of his arguments and examples.
Provide constructive feedback: After evaluating the writing tests, provide candidates with detailed feedback on their strengths and weaknesses to help them improve.
Consider the entire test: Finally, consider the entire test in your overall assessment, taking into account all of the aspects mentioned above to get a complete view of the candidate's writing skills.
By following these steps, you should be able to conduct an effective writing test to assess candidates' writing skills.
How to have good writing skills?
To develop good writing skills, here are some tips:
Read regularly: Reading books, articles, blogs, and other forms of writing exposes you to different writing styles and techniques, which enriches your own literary background.
Write Every Day: Practice writing regularly to improve your fluency and creativity. Set a daily writing goal, even if it’s just a few lines.
Get constructive feedback: Share your writing with others and ask for their opinions. Constructive feedback will help you identify your strengths and weaknesses so you can improve them.
Study Grammar and Syntax: Having a good command of grammar, spelling, and syntax is essential to producing clear, coherent text.
Experiment with different writing styles: Try different literary genres, narrative techniques, and tones to develop your own unique style.
Revise and edit your writing: Take the time to carefully proofread your texts to correct errors, improve sentence structure, and refine your message.
Enrich your vocabulary: Learn new words regularly to enrich your written expression and avoid repetitions.
Research the topics covered: If you are writing about specific topics, do thorough research to ensure you provide accurate and relevant information.
Set goals: Establish specific improvement goals, such as reducing the use of a frequent word or improving the clarity of your sentences, and work consistently to achieve them.
Practice Patience: Writing skills improve with time and practice. Be patient with yourself and keep writing regularly to improve.
By following these tips and being persistent, you can develop good writing skills and improve your writing style.
